Great cottage by the seaside
We spent one week at the cottage with another couple in late May. The cottage is well situated, with the seaside park and beach literally across the street, in the lovely town of Greystones, south of Dublin. The cottage is very well appointed with a nice kitchen and comfortable bedrooms, all with stunning views of the Irish Sea. The owners were very friendly and gave us many tips on what to visit in the surrounding area. There is a nice pub located a five minute walk away, with other restaurants nearby on the high street. There is a paved walking/cycling path along the shore just outside the cottage and a longer Cliff Walk that goes north to Bray. The Greystones station is a 10 minute walk, with good commuter service to downtown Dublin (a 50 minute ride). Since the Dublin traffic is pretty much a nightmare, the train was very useful. There is also service to the south for visiting Wicklow etc. Sights nearby that we visited by car included Powerscourt waterfall and gardens, the stunning Wicklow mountains, Avoca woolen mill, and the amazing Neolithic passage grave at Newgrange, north of Dublin. We greatly enjoyed our stay at the cottage and I can recommend it highly as a base for exploring Dublin and the surrounding countryside.
